What is special about the bus chassis supplied by MAN is that they combine
low floors throughout with a vehicle length of 18.75 metres. This construction,
together with the body's four double doors, makes for especially time-saving
boarding and alighting, a vital feature of an efficient BRT system.
The EEV standard sets considerably lower limits for particulate emission than
the Euro 5 standard currently applicable in Europe. The EEV diesel engines
from MAN fulfil these exhaust standards without the use of the additive AdBlue®
- in other words, the buses only require filling up with diesel fuel.

MAN is the market leader for city buses in Israel. The basis of over thirty years
of cooperation between DAN and MAN is the reliability of the buses: almost
every single one of DAN's fleet of 1,200 buses is built on an MAN chassis.

Bus Rapid Transit systems enable the modernisation of a city's transport
infrastructure without the need for extensive construction work on building
underground lines. In principle, BRT systems can be compared with inner-city
rail systems such as trams and metros, but they can be constructed more
quickly and more economically, besides having far more flexibility. BRT systems
are relatively easy to integrate into existing urban structures and are not reliant
on an exclusive infrastructure end-to-end. Buses are more flexible and can
make detours when the unforeseen happens (blocked streets), thus ensuring
with a greater degree of certainty that passengers will arrive at their
destinations.
The foundation of any BRT system is formed by modern city buses with high
passenger capacities. Other characteristics are separate lanes and platform
stops where tickets are sold and access is automatically controlled – i.e. before
the bus is boarded, in order to optimise the passenger flow. BRT systems also
offer intelligent traffic management as well as passenger information and
automatic display of the upcoming departure times, to mention just two
examples. An infrastructure specifically for buses ensures that passengers are
conveyed rapidly, smoothly and comfortably.
